Isomorfismo: Guia completo sobre o conceito, exemplos e aplicações

Pre

O termo Isomorfismo aparece em várias áreas da matemática e da ciência da computação como a ideia de que duas estruturas distintas podem, essencialmente, ser a mesma por trás de suas aparências. Quando duas estruturas são Isomorfismo entre si, isso significa que existe uma correspondência que preserva a organização interna: operações, relações ou propriedades que definem a estrutura original permanecem intactas sob o mapeamento. Este conceito é poderoso porque permite transferir resultados, teoremas e insights de uma estrutura para outra, economizando esforço e abrindo portas para generalizações profundas.

O que é Isomorfismo?

Isomorfismo é uma noção de equivalência estrutural. Em termos simples, duas estruturas matemáticas A e B são Isomorfismo se houver uma função bijetiva f: A → B que preserva a operação ou a relação fundamental da estrutura. Quando isso acontece, diz-se que A e B possuem a mesma forma, a mesma organização interna, mesmo que seus elementos concretos possam ser diferentes.

Existem diferentes maneiras de definir Isomorfismo, de acordo com o tipo de estrutura que estamos tratando. Em grupos, anéis, espaços vetoriais e grafos, por exemplo, a ideia central é preservar a operação de composição, adição, multiplicação ou a adjacência de vértices. Em termos conceituais, Isomorfismo significa que estruturas diferentes podem ser consideradas equivalentes do ponto de vista da teoria estrutural.

Isomorfismo em diferentes áreas da matemática

Isomorfismo em Grupos

Num grupo, a operação é tipicamente a multiplicação ou adição, e o Isomorfismo entre dois grupos G e H é uma bijeção f: G → H que satisfaz f(xy) = f(x)f(y) para todos x, y em G. Se existir tal função, G e H possuem a mesma estrutura de grupo, com a mesma ordem de elementos e a mesma maneira de combinar elementos.

Exemplos clássicos incluem o isomorfismo entre o grupo dos inteiros Z sob adição e o grupo dos pares de inteiros Z sob adição, via mapeamento n ↦ (n, 0) ou, de forma mais clara, entre Z e 2Z com a adição usual. Embora os conjuntos pareçam diferentes, eles compartilham a mesma estrutura de grupo sob adição: são isomorfos.

Isomorfismo em Anéis

Em anéis, o Isomorfismo preserva não apenas a adição, mas também a multiplicação. Ou seja, f: R → S é um isomorfismo de anéis se for bijetiva, preservando adição e multiplicação: f(a + b) = f(a) + f(b) e f(ab) = f(a)f(b). Quando existe, R e S são estruturalmente idênticos sob a ótica da álgebra de anéis.

Um exemplo pedagógico é o isomorfismo entre o anel dos polinômios com coeficientes reais R[x] e o anel de funções polinomiais reais simplificadas, desde que consideremos as operações de forma apropriada. Em muitos casos, a ideia prática é mostrar como uma troca de representações não altera a “forma” algébrica subjacente.

Isomorfismo em Espaços Vetoriais

Para espaços vetoriais, Isomorfismo significa existência de uma transformação linear bijetiva entre dois espaços. Se V e W são espaços vetoriais sobre o mesmo corpo, um isomorfismo é uma função linear f: V → W que é bijetiva. A consequência é que V e W possuem exatamente a mesma estrutura de espaço vetorial: mesmos limites, mesma dimensão, mesma base, apenas com uma “reorganização” dos elementos.

Um exemplo elegante é o isomorfismo entre R^2 com a base canônica e R^2 com outra base, como a transformada por uma matriz invertível A. A função f(v) = Av é um isomorfismo, pois A é invertível e preserva a adição de vetores e a multiplicação por escalares. Em termos práticos, qualquer par de coordenadas pode ser reorganizado para representar a mesma geometria de forma diferente.

Isomorfismo entre Grafos

Graph isomorphism é uma noção de equivalência entre grafos. Dois grafos G = (V, E) e H = (W, F) são isomorfos se houver uma bijecção φ: V → W que preserve as conexões: para quaisquer vértices u, v em V, U é adjacente a V se, e somente se, φ(U) é adjacente a φ(V) em W. Em termos simples, os grafos são “os mesmos em estrutura” se nada relevante sobre como os vértices se ligam for perdido pela correspondência.

Este conceito é extremamente importante em ciência da computação, teoria de redes, química computacional e muita matemática discreta. A prova de isomorfismo entre grafos pode ser trivial em alguns casos, ou desafiadora em outros, levando a uma área de estudo com algoritmos sofisticados para identificar correspondências entre grafos complexos.

Características e propriedades do Isomorfismo

Propriedade transitiva e equivalência de classes

Se A é Isomorfismo com B e B é Isomorfismo com C, então A é Isomorfismo com C. Essa propriedade, combinada com a reflexividade (A é Isomorfismo com A) e a simetria (se A é Isomorfismo com B, então B é Isomorfismo com A), faz do Isomorfismo uma relação de equivalência. Assim, as estruturas podem ser particionadas em classes de equivalência, cada uma representando uma “forma” única.

Inverso e composições

Se f: A → B é um Isomorfismo, então existe um isomorfismo inverso g: B → A. A composição de isomorfismos também é isomórfica: se f: A → B e g: B → C são isomorfismos, então a composição g ∘ f: A → C é um Isomorfismo. Essa propriedade facilita a construção de caminhos entre estruturas diferentes por meio de várias etapas de mapeamento.

Preservação de invariantes

Isomorfismos preservam invariantes essenciais: ordem de elementos em grupos, dimensão em espaços vetoriais, grau de vértices em grafos, entre outros. Invariantes atuam como ferramentas para reconhecer quando estruturas não podem ser Isomorfismo entre si, servindo como técnicas de descarte rápido em problemas de identificação.

Como reconhecer um Isomorfismo

Passos práticos para verificar a Isomorfia

  • Defina claramente as estruturas envolvidas (operações, relações, dimensões, adjacências).
  • Busque uma função candidata F: A → B que seja bijetiva (ou seja, injetiva e sobrejetiva).
  • Verifique a preservação da operação principal: para grupos, f(xy) = f(x)f(y); para espaços vetoriais, f(ax + by) = a f(x) + b f(y); para grafos, preserve adjacências.
  • Confirme o inverso: existe g: B → A tal que g(f(x)) = x para todo x em A.
  • Checar invariantes relevantes para eliminar impossibilidades rápidas (por exemplo, dimensões diferentes, orden de elementos, conectividade de grafos, etc.).

Estratégias comuns

Em prática, é comum começar pelo estudo de invariantes simples (dimensão, ordem, número de geradores) e, se necessário, avançar para a construção explícita do isomorfismo. Em espaços vetoriais, por exemplo, basta demonstrar que duas bases têm a mesma cardinalidade e que existe uma transformação linear entre elas com inversa. Em grafos, inspeções visuais podem ajudar, mas para grafos grandes, algoritmos de isomorfismo utilizam heurísticas e técnicas computacionais avançadas.

Exemplos práticos de Isomorfismo

Exemplo 1: Isomorfismo entre Z e 2Z

Considere o grupo dos inteiros Z com adição e o subgrupo 2Z formado por todos os múltiplos de 2. A função f: Z → 2Z definida por f(n) = 2n é bijetiva entre Z e 2Z, e preserva a adição: f(n + m) = 2(n + m) = 2n + 2m = f(n) + f(m). Assim, Z é Isomorfismo com 2Z, o que ilustra como estruturas aparentemente diferentes podem ter a mesma forma algébrica sob a ótica da adição.

Exemplo 2: Isomorfismo entre Espaços Vetoriais V e W

Considere V = R^2 e W = R^2. A transformação linear f(x, y) = (x + y, x – y) é bijetiva, pois sua matriz associada é invertível ((1,1); (1,-1)) com determinante -2. Logo, f é um Isomorfismo entre V e W. O inverso f⁻¹ é dado por f⁻¹(u, v) = ((u + v)/2, (u – v)/2). Esse exemplo mostra claramente a ideia de isomorfismo em espaços vetoriais: duas representações diferentes do mesmo espaço podem ser conectadas por uma transformação linear invertível.

Exemplo 3: Isomorfismo entre grafos simples

Considere dois grafos G1 e G2 com três vértices cada, onde G1 tem arestas conectando 1-2, 2-3, 3-1, formando um triângulo, e G2 tem arestas conectando A-B, B-C, C-A, também formando um triângulo. Existe uma bijecção φ de vértices que preserva as adjacências: φ(1) = A, φ(2) = B, φ(3) = C. Assim, G1 é Isomorfismo a G2. Mesmo que os vértices sejam diferentes, as estruturas de conectividade são idênticas.

Aplicações do Isomorfismo

Na matemática e na física

O Isomorfismo permite reduzir problemas complexos a problemas equivalentes em estruturas mais simples ou já conhecidas. Em teoria de grupos, por exemplo, classificar grupos de uma dada ordem depende de entender as classes de isomorfismo; isso evita duplicatas e facilita a organização de resultados. Em física, as simetrias são descritas por grupos; entender isomorfismos entre grupos de simetria ajuda a identificar leis físicas equivalentes sob transformações de coordenadas ou mudanças de base.

Na ciência da computação

No campo da teoria da computação e da ciência de dados, o Isomorfismo de grafos é fundamental em problemas de correspondência de estruturas, reconhecimento de padrões, redes neurais e química computacional. Detectar se dois grafos representam a mesma conectividade pode acelerar buscas, otimizar redes e facilitar a modelagem de moléculas. Além disso, transformações entre representações de dados, quando preservam a estrutura, permitem otimizações e interoperabilidade entre sistemas.

Na matemática discreta e algébrica

Em combinatória, o Isomorfismo de estruturas algébricas simplifica a comparação entre objetos combinatórios; em teoria de números, isomorfismos entre anéis ou módulos ajudam a compreender propriedades aritméticas de maneira mais ampla. O conceito atua como ponte entre diferentes áreas, abrindo caminhos para teoremas mais gerais que valem em contextos variados.

Desafios, curiosidades e limites do Isomorfismo

O problema do Isomorfismo de grafos

O problema de determinar se dois grafos são isomorfos, conhecido como Graph Isomorphism, é um dos problemas clássicos em ciência da computação. Embora não seja comprovadamente NP-completo nem resolvido em tempo polinomial em todos os casos, há algoritmos práticos que resolvem muitos casos reais de forma eficiente. A complexidade teórica do GI permanece um tópico ativo de pesquisa, com implicações para criptografia, design de redes e teoria de algoritmos.

Limites conceituais

Nem toda correspondência entre estruturas pode ser Isomorfismo. Em alguns contextos, estruturas podem ser semelhantes mas não completamente equivalentes sob uma transformação que preserve toda a essência de suas operações. A presença de invariantes fortes pode impedir a existência de Isomorfismo entre estruturas aparentemente parecidas, lembrando que a equivalência estrutural tem fronteiras bem definidas por axiomas e definições formais.

Isomorfismo como ferramenta de estudo e prática

O valor do Isomorfismo está na sua capacidade de simplificar a compreensão de estruturas complexas, trazendo transparência através de uma visão unificada. Ao identificar isomorfismos, estudantes e pesquisadores descobrem que problemas difíceis podem ter soluções mais diretas em outra representação. A prática de buscar isomorfismos envolve observar padrões, invariantes e transformações que preservam a organização essencial da matemática ou da teoria computacional em questão.

Como transformar o estudo de Isomorfismo em aprendizado ativo

  • Estude casos simples de isomorfismo em grupos, como adição de inteiros e seus subgrupos, para internalizar o conceito de preservação de operações.
  • Explore isomorfismos entre espaços vetoriais por meio de matrizes invertíveis, praticando com transformações lineares fáceis de visualizar.
  • Faça comparações entre grafos pequenos para entender o que significa preservar adjacências sem perder a bijetividade.
  • Analise invariantes para reconhecer quando um isomorfismo é impossível, fortalecendo o raciocínio lógico na identificação de não-equivalências.

Resumo final sobre Isomorfismo

Isomorfismo é, essencialmente, a ideia de que duas estruturas distintas podem ser, do ponto de vista matemático, a mesma sob uma correspondência que preserva suas regras internas. Ao dominar o conceito de Isomorfismo, você ganha uma ferramenta poderosa para reconhecer equivalências, transferir resultados entre áreas diferentes e entender melhor a beleza da matemática como uma ciência de padrões universais. A prática com exemplos concretos em grupos, anéis, espaços vetoriais e grafos ajuda a tornar o conceito vivo, aplicável e, acima de tudo, intuitivo.

Conclusão

Ao investir tempo no estudo do Isomorfismo, você constrói uma base sólida para navegar por muitos ramos da matemática com mais clareza. A capacidade de identificar quando estruturas são Isomorfismo entre si não apenas facilita a resolução de problemas, mas também ilumina as conexões escondidas entre áreas distintas. Com aplicações que vão da teoria à prática computacional, o Isomorfismo permanece como um dos pilares da compreensão estrutural, permitindo que ideias complexas se organizem de forma elegante, previsível e surpreendente.